What Are the Key Features to Consider When Choosing a Mini Cordless Chainsaw?
Weight and portability are especially important for mini cordless chainsaws, as lighter models can be easily maneuvered and used for extended periods without causing fatigue. This feature is particularly beneficial for users who need to navigate tight spaces or work overhead.
Bar length affects the versatility of the chainsaw; shorter bars are typically easier to handle for small jobs, while longer bars allow for tackling larger branches and logs. Assess the types of tasks you’ll be performing to select the appropriate bar length for your needs.
Chain speed is another key feature, as a faster chain speed can significantly reduce cutting time, especially when working with hard or thick materials. This feature can greatly enhance your efficiency, making it an important consideration for serious users.
Safety features are non-negotiable when operating power tools. Look for chainsaws equipped with features such as chain brakes, which halt the chain’s movement upon release, and hand guards to protect against accidental contact with the chain.
Ergonomics play a significant role in your comfort and control during use. A well-designed handle that fits comfortably in your hand will reduce strain and improve precision, especially during detailed or prolonged cutting tasks.
Finally, durability and build quality are essential for ensuring that your investment lasts over time. Chainsaws made from high-quality materials will withstand regular use and harsh conditions, maintaining their performance and safety features for years to come.
How Important Is Battery Life for Mini Cordless Chainsaws?
Battery life is a critical factor to consider when selecting the best mini cordless chainsaw, as it directly affects usability and efficiency.
- Runtime: The runtime of a cordless chainsaw determines how long you can use it on a single charge before needing to recharge the battery. A chainsaw with a longer runtime allows for extended work sessions, making it more convenient for tasks like trimming or pruning without frequent interruptions.
- Charge Time: The time it takes to recharge the battery is also essential, especially if you plan to use the chainsaw for larger projects. Chainsaws that offer quick charge capabilities can minimize downtime, allowing you to get back to work faster.
- Battery Capacity: Measured in amp-hours (Ah), battery capacity affects both the runtime and power output of the chainsaw. A higher capacity battery typically provides more power and longer usage time, which is advantageous for cutting through tougher materials.
- Battery Type: The type of battery, such as lithium-ion or nickel-cadmium, impacts performance and longevity. Lithium-ion batteries are generally lighter, have a longer lifespan, and offer consistent power delivery, making them ideal for mini cordless chainsaws.
- Indicator Features: Some chainsaws come with battery life indicators, which provide a visual cue of remaining power. This feature is helpful for planning your work and ensuring you don’t run out of battery unexpectedly during a job.
What Role Does Chain Speed Play in Performance?
Chain speed is a crucial factor in determining the performance of a mini cordless chainsaw.
- Cutting Efficiency: Chain speed directly affects how quickly the chainsaw can cut through wood. A higher chain speed allows the saw to make faster cuts, which is particularly beneficial for tasks requiring precision and speed, such as trimming or pruning.
- Power Consumption: The speed of the chain can influence the overall power consumption of the chainsaw. Higher chain speeds may lead to increased battery drain, meaning that while a faster speed can improve cutting efficiency, it may also require more frequent recharging, impacting the tool’s usability over extended periods.
- Kickback Risk: Chain speed can also influence the risk of kickback, which is when the saw unexpectedly jumps back toward the user. Higher speeds can increase the likelihood of kickback if not handled properly, making it essential for users to be aware of safe handling practices and to use protective gear.
- Material Suitability: Different materials require different chain speeds for optimal cutting. For example, cutting through softwoods may require a different chain speed compared to hardwoods, and understanding the appropriate speed can help the user select the right settings for their specific cutting tasks.
- Durability of Chain and Bar: The speed at which the chain operates can affect the wear and tear on both the chain and the guide bar. Excessive speeds can lead to faster degradation of these components, necessitating more frequent maintenance and replacement to ensure the chainsaw continues to function effectively.

How Can You Properly Maintain Your Mini Cordless Chainsaw for Longevity?
Proper maintenance of your mini cordless chainsaw is essential to ensure its longevity and optimal performance. Follow these key practices:
-
Regular Cleaning: After each use, clean the chainsaw to remove sawdust, debris, and sap buildup. Wipe down the chains, guide bars, and other surfaces with a damp cloth.
-
Chain Tension Adjustment: Check the chain tension before every use. A properly tensioned chain reduces wear on the motor and improves cutting efficiency. If the chain is too loose, adjust it according to the manufacturer’s guidelines.
-
Lubrication: Regularly lubricate the chain and guide bar with high-quality bar and chain oil. This reduces friction and prolongs the life of the components. Always ensure the oil reservoir is filled before each use.
-
Battery Maintenance: Charge the battery according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Avoid letting the battery deplete completely and store it in a cool, dry place when not in use.
-
Sharpening the Chain: A dull chain not only makes cutting inefficient but also strains the motor. Sharpen the chain regularly using a chainsaw sharpening tool or take it to a professional.
Implementing these practices will enhance the performance and durability of your mini cordless chainsaw, making it a reliable tool for your cutting needs.
What Safety Precautions Should Be Taken When Operating a Mini Cordless Chainsaw?
When operating a mini cordless chainsaw, several safety precautions are essential to ensure safe and effective use.
- Wear Protective Gear: Always wear appropriate safety gear, including gloves, goggles, and a hard hat. This equipment protects against flying debris and potential injuries from the chainsaw.
- Inspect the Chainsaw: Before use, thoroughly inspect the chainsaw for any potential issues, such as a dull chain or loose parts. A well-maintained tool is less likely to malfunction and can operate more effectively.
- Use the Chainsaw Correctly: Familiarize yourself with the operating manual and ensure you know how to handle the chainsaw properly. Proper technique reduces the risk of accidents and increases cutting efficiency.
- Maintain a Safe Work Environment: Clear the area of any obstacles and ensure there is adequate space to maneuver. A clutter-free workspace minimizes the risk of tripping or encountering unexpected hazards.
- Keep Others at a Safe Distance: Maintain a safe distance from onlookers, especially children and pets. A minimum distance of at least 10 feet is recommended to avoid any accidents from flying debris or loss of control.
- Be Aware of Your Surroundings: Always be mindful of your environment, including overhead hazards like power lines or unstable branches. Awareness helps prevent accidents and ensures a safer cutting experience.
- Use Two Hands: Always operate the chainsaw with both hands on the handle for better control and stability. This practice reduces the likelihood of losing grip and enables better handling during use.
- Turn Off the Chainsaw When Not in Use: Always turn off the chainsaw when taking breaks or moving between cuts. This simple step reduces the risk of accidental starts or injuries while you’re not actively cutting.
